Classic Leader Foundation, a newly registered NGO known for its long-running educational outreach across Uganda, has commissioned a Shs 300 million multipurpose hall at Mbuya C.O.U Primary School, marking one of its largest community investments to date.

The facility, named the P. V. Shah Memorial Multipurpose Hall, was donated by the Foundation’s chairman, Mr. Priyesh Pravinchandra Shah, in memory of his late father. The hall is expected to serve as a learning, cultural, and community space for pupils and residents within the area.

According to the Foundation, the project reflects a new phase in its expanded mission following its formal registration in 2025 as an NGO under the name Classic Leader Foundation (Registration No. 8298).

Classic, a household name in scholastic materials, began its education support initiatives in 2017 as part of its corporate social responsibility. The Foundation says its outreach now reaches over 10,000 schools annually with educational materials, sports equipment, student kits, and scholarships.

Foundation records show yearly distributions of over 480 scholarships, 4,000 student kits, 3,000 footballs, 2,500 wall clocks, and thousands of maps and exercise books to schools across Uganda.

Officials from the Foundation said more than 40 schools in 40 districts currently receive termly scholarships. The organisation announced plans to replicate the multipurpose hall model in more schools nationwide.

Under its 2030 Vision, the Foundation aims to support 5,000 scholarships annually across 1,000 schools.

Classic Leader Foundation says its work is guided by the motto “Empowering Minds, Transforming Lives in Africa.”
